nonsensical
ˌnɒnˈsɛnsɪkəl
Definition Synonyms

Definition of nonsensical - Reverso English Dictionary

Adjective

not logicalnot making sense or impossible to understand
  • That explanation is completely nonsensical.
  • His nonsensical claims undermined the debate.
  • The report contained nonsensical figures throughout.
absurd illogical preposterous
